ANALYSIS AND DESIGN OF ELASTIC BEAMS; CONTENTS; PREFACE; 1 BEAMS IN BENDING; 2 BEAM ELEMENTS; 3 BEAM SYSTEMS; 4 FINITE ELEMENTS FOR CROSS-SECTIONAL ANALYSIS; 5 SAINT-VENANT TORSION; 6 BEAMS UNDER TRANSVERSE SHEAR LOADS; 7 RESTRAINED WARPING OF BEAMS; 8 ANALYSIS OF STRESS; 9 RATIONAL B-SPLINE CURVES; 10 SHAPE OPTIMIZATION OF THIN-WALLED SECTIONS; APPENDIX A USING THE COMPUTER PROGRAMS; APPENDIX B NUMERICAL EXAMPLES; INDEX.
Analysis and Design of Elastic Beams presents computer models and applications related to thin-walled beams such as those used in mechanical and aerospace designs, where thin, lightweight structures with high strength are needed. This book will enable readers to compute the cross-sectional properties of individual beams with arbitrary cross-sectional shapes, to apply a general-purpose computer analysis of a complete structure to determine the forces and moments in the individual members, and to use a unified approach for calculating the normal and shear stresses, as well as deflections, for t.
